I am expanding my design business to add t-shirts. How is the best way to go about this?

well if you are going to be making them, i suggest looking at some of the featured threads on the homepage. if you are designing them, just sit down and get creative. make sure they are in vector format and you separate the colors. then get you a t-shirt template online and put the design on it.

Hi Candy,
What is your original business model? And where are you located (retail, warehouse, home based)? Do you have customers already or will you just start advertising?

There are a couple of ways to go. You could "test the waters" by establishing a relationship with a wholesaler, I can help with that. Or you can purchase the necessary equipment to get started. An easy way to go depending on the volumes you intend to offer is DTG. I have four stores all using DTG very successfully.

Good luck!
